Daily Prayer and Bible Time

One of the most important parts of my day is spending time with God.

Sometimes that happens first thing in the morning. Other days it happens later in the afternoon when I can sit outside on the back steps with my Bible App and a soda and simply enjoy God's creation. Those moments have become some of my favorites.

I find myself thanking God for the simple things I once hurried past-the blue skies, the puffy clouds, the green grass, the trees, and even the little birds that stop by my feeder.

Living with PNES has forced me to slow down. While I never would have chosen this journey, slowing down has helped me notice blessings that were there all along.

Prayer has become less about routine and more about relationship. It is where I bring God my fears, my gratitude, my questions, and my hopes for tomorrow.

Whether I'm reading Scripture, listening quietly, or simply watching the birds outside, those moments remind me that God is still present, still faithful, and still writing my story.

Creativity Through Storytelling

Stories have always lived in my imagination—long before PNES entered my life. I was always creating characters, adventures, and "what if" worlds in my mind.

After my diagnosis, I worried that part of me had been lost. Creating stories helped me discover that it wasn't gone—it was simply waiting for a new way to be expressed.

AI has become a creative partner that helps me transform ideas into scripts, characters, settings, and audio dramas. It allows me to bring stories to life in ways I never could before.

Some stories are inspired by childhood memories. Some are adventures. Some are simply creative exercises. Together, they have become another part of my healing journey—a reminder that creativity can survive even when life changes unexpectedly.

Creating stories reminded me that PNES had changed my life,

but it had not taken away my imagination.

Creating with AI

AI has also played a role in shaping Seizing Hope.

When we first began imagining the website, we had ideas, notes, and a vision, but it was often difficult to picture how everything would come together. AI helped transform those ideas into visual mockups that gave us direction and inspiration as we built each page.

It didn't create our story, our faith, or our purpose. Those were already there. What it did was help us see new possibilities and provide a roadmap for bringing our vision to life.

For me, AI has become more than a technology tool. It has become a creative partner—helping me explore stories, scripts, songs, images, and audio dramas. Through that process, I rediscovered a part of myself that I thought had been lost.

Music That Helped Me Find Joy Again

One day, Diane gave me a personalized song. That gift sparked something unexpected—it inspired me to explore songwriting and begin creating music of my own.

Some songs are reflective. Some are faith-filled. Some are about living with PNES. Not everything I have created has been serious—I have made some really silly songs, too. But for this website, I wanted to share the songs that helped me express what I was feeling when words alone were not enough.

Creating music helped me rediscover joy.
